Well, considering that the hardware is the same they effectively *DO* relay two different firmwares for the old Cybook as people might install the Weltbild one, e.g. if they buy mostly from one of the publishers preferring ePub.
The different brand would just be useful to help people along (one would have to know which FW they have to effectively help) and avoid confusion when selling a pre-owned Cybook.
It also wouldn't have to be an entirely different brand. A simple "Cybook Gen3+" or "Cybook Gen3 ePub edition" would suffice. People on the forum here could just ask users to read the label to them and would know which type of the Cybook they have.

The only good thing about format wars is that many people realise how dangerous it is to have DRM as they stand to lose all their books when their format dies. Only DRM-free books are a safe investment as there will always be some kind soul out there to write a conversion utility.
